Many entrepreneurs unknowingly operate from survival patterns:

  • proving your worth through achievement

  • tying productivity to self-esteem

  • feeling responsible for everyone and everything

  • struggling to rest without guilt

  • believing slowing down means failure

WHy Therapy Intensives?

Therapist and Client

Traditional weekly therapy can feel difficult to sustain when you already feel mentally overloaded and stretched thin.

Therapy intensives provide focused, in-depth support over 1–3 days so we can go beyond surface-level conversations and create meaningful movement faster.
